Why can’t I change the Pandora station with Soundtouch on my TV?


This week we had a couple calls from clients questioning why they couldn’t change their Pandora station using the Bose Soundtouch app on their TV’s. Although both clients had the same problem, there were 2 different causes. In the 1stcase, the client had a smart TV and had accessed the Pandora service from the Smart TV options, not from the Bose Soundtouch app. Remember, you must select your music service through the Bose Soundtouch app to control it with the app and have the ability to play it throughout your home. In the 2ndinstance, the client had correctly selected Soundtouch as the source on the TV but complained that, although they saw the Pandora logo on the TV, the same Pandora station kept playing and couldn’t change it. The reason is you can only change the Pandora station using the app on your phone or computer. You can’t change any music service station using your TV, you can only access your presets and your “recents”.
